Overview
The Online Associate of Applied Science in Management from Louisiana State University integrates theory with practical application to help you develop the communication and decision-making skills that are crucial for flourishing in any leadership role. In the programme, you’ll also learn the skills to earn industry-recognized credentials like Microsoft Office Specialist or TestOut Office Pro Certification and gain a competitive edge in the job market.
This degree also offers an optional concentration in Administrative Management, enabling you to integrate various business courses into a comprehensive programme that meets the demands of today's business world.

Other requirements
General requirements
- Applicants for admission to the freshman class are normally required to submit scores on the American College Test (ACT) in order to be placed at the appropriate levels in freshman courses, for counseling, and for selection of scholarship recipients.
- Graduates of state-approved high schools or those who hold a G.E.D or HiSET and have not attended another college or university will be considered for admission when they have made an application.
- Louisiana residents who are not graduates of state-approved high schools and have not attended another college or university may apply for admission by submitting their G.E.D. or HiSET transcript.
- Louisiana residents who have graduated from a high school not approved by the State Department of Education or who do not have a G.E.D. or HiSET can be admitted under the Ability to Benefit provision.
